Yes; Ecstasy has been used in psychotherapy. It may help relieve pain and emotional distress of terminal cancer patients and speed the recovery of soldiers suffering from post-traumatic stress disorder. Roughly half a million doses were administered for treatment of depression, anxiety, rape-related trauma, and even schizophrenia.
